#7d959c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d959c is composed of 49% red, 58.4%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.9% cyan, 4.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 193.5 degrees, a saturation of 13.5% and a lightness of 55.1%. #7d959c color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#002b39.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#7d959c color description : Dark grayish cyan.
#7d959c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d959c has RGB values of R:125, G:149,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 8230300.

Shades and Tints of #7d959c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030304 is the darkest color, while #f7f9f9 is the lightest one.
